Transaction e2e523ddb83c96439b2b5ed0010778d206b38d347cfe5946bea89a4b0c7963e4

28 Input
2 Outputs
  • e2e523ddb83c96439b2b5ed0010778d206b38d347cfe5946bea89a4b0c7963e4:0
  • value  167556
    address  1C3bdkwzSHBF3hAYtUjA7mHdHSjUDhnei9
  • e2e523ddb83c96439b2b5ed0010778d206b38d347cfe5946bea89a4b0c7963e4:1
  • value  2700000
    address  1NyMyj8V8K2WRL1SgRurjVz6Q6UjNVoCcX